Theme of Fulfilling Vows and Spiritual Charity in Attar's Tale of Mahmud and the Spoils
In this tale from Attar's The Conference of the Birds, Sultan Mahmud vows to distribute all war spoils to dervishes if God grants him victory over a formidable Indian army. Upon achieving his conquest, Mahmud faithfully honors his vow despite the immense material value of the gathered treasure. This allegory emphasizes the paramount Sufi virtues of keeping spiritual covenants with the divine, the superiority of charity over worldly wealth, and the ethical obligation of rulers to remain steadfast in their spiritual promises.
